You are given two different length strings that have the characteristic that they both take exactly one hour to burn. However, neither string burns at a constant rate. Some sections of the strings burn very fast, other sections burn very slow. All you have do is calculate when exactly 45 minutes has elapsed? A.    1. Light both ends of the first string         2. Light end of the second string at the same time.         3. When the first string is finished burning,         4. Light the unlit end of the second string. B.    1. Light both ends of the second string         2. Light beginning of the first string at the same time.         3. When the first string is finished burning,         4. Light the unlit end of the second string. C.    1. Light end of the first string         2. Light end of the second string at the same time         3. When the first string is finished burning,         4. Light the unlit end of the second string.  D. None of these
